Techniques covered in this class:
The techniques you learn in this class will help you with many of your woodworking projects. Here’s what we’ll cover:
- Making and cutting in bowties
- Creating a liquid inlay using colored epoxy resin
- Using a router as a biscuit joiner
- Routing perfectly evenly spaced grooves
- Making bowls and trays with a router and template
- Routing specialized slots for fastening solid wood tops and allowing expansion
- Using templates and a specialized guide bushing to create inlays
- When to replace your router collets
- Super simple shop-made dado jig

George Vondriska
George Vondriska is the Editor in Chief here at Woodworkers Guild of America and has been sharing his woodworking expertise since 1986. Apart from conducting classes at his renowned Vondriska Woodworks School, George's passion for teaching has taken him to woodworking shows nationwide and has led him to teach woodworking for prestigious organizations such as Peace Corps/Swaziland, Andersen Window, Northwest Airlines, and the Pentagon. With a wealth of published magazine articles under his belt, encompassing tool reviews and shop improvement projects, George's knowledge and skills continue to inspire woodworkers every day.
